#!/usr/bin/env node

// Unit tests for sync-org-docs.mjs.
//
// Tests the pure helper functions used by the org-wide doc aggregation
// script. Clone/git/gh operations are not tested here — those are
// integration/end-to-end concerns.
//
// Usage:
// node scripts/__tests__/sync-org-docs.test.mjs

import { strict as assert } from 'node:assert';
import { readFileSync } from 'node:fs';
import { fileURLToPath } from 'node:url';
import { dirname, join } from 'node:path';

// ── Import the module under test ──────────────────────────────────────────────
const __dirname = dirname(fileURLToPath(import.meta.url));
const scriptPath = join(__dirname, '..', 'sync-org-docs.mjs');

// Since sync-org-docs.mjs is a script (not an ES module with exports),
// we eval the source to extract its functions for testing.
// This avoids needing to refactor the script to export its helpers.
let scriptSource;
try {
scriptSource = readFileSync(scriptPath, 'utf8');
} catch (e) {
console.error(`Cannot read script at ${scriptPath}: ${e.message}`);
process.exit(1);
}

// Wrap the script source in a function so we can capture its internals
const scriptFn = new Function(`
const module = { exports: {} };
const __dirname = '${__dirname.replace(/\\/g, '\\\\')}';
${scriptSource}
return module.exports;
`);
const exports = scriptFn();

// The script uses top-level function declarations — new Function won't capture them.
// Instead, let's reimplement the pure functions based on the source to test
// the logic independently. We export the tested implementations by eval'ing
// individual function definitions.

function extractFunction(name) {
// Match 'function <name>(...)' or '<name> = (...) =>'
const regex = new RegExp(
`(?:^|\\n)\\s*(?:export\\s+)?(?:function\\s+${name}|const\\s+${name}\\s*=|let\\s+${name}\\s*=|var\\s+${name}\\s*=)\\s*([^]*?)(?=\\n\\S|$)`,
'm'
);
const match = scriptSource.match(regex);
if (!match) {
throw new Error(`Could not extract function '${name}' from script`);
}
// Get the full match and build a standalone function
const block = match[0];
try {
return (0, eval)(`(function() {\n${block}\nreturn ${name};\n})()`);
} catch (e) {
throw new Error(`Failed to eval '${name}': ${e.message}`);
}
}

// ── Test helpers ──────────────────────────────────────────────────────────────
let pass = 0;
let fail = 0;

function test(name, fn) {
try {
fn();
pass++;
console.log(` ✓ ${name}`);
} catch (e) {
fail++;
console.error(` ✗ ${name}: ${e.message}`);
}
}

function summary() {
console.log(`\n${pass} passed, ${fail} failed`);
if (fail > 0) process.exit(1);
}
